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53 451223 604 168 25126722
3174870816 72 89643720
3174870816 72 89643720
34 2221986602 71
All about undefined
Interested in learning more?
3174870816 72 89643720
34 2221986602 71
See more
968 0442143 991
189 092031243 89996 68 9236377844
See more
21508785 1433 08
827536 51921 19752664
See more